1. 30 Jan, 2020 1 commit
  2. 22 Nov, 2019 1 commit
    • Pekka Paalanen's avatar
      tests: replace fprintf() with testlog() · 12a138d5
      Pekka Paalanen authored
      
      
      When we move on to TAP, stdout will be reserved for TAP and stderr is for free
      chatter. Set up an example that tests should use testlog() instead of fprintf
      or printf to chat in the right place.
      
      Most statements were already printing to stderr, so this just makes then a
      little shorter. There are also some statements that printed to stdout and are
      now corrected.
      Signed-off-by: default avatarPekka Paalanen <pekka.paalanen@collabora.com>
      12a138d5
  3. 13 Mar, 2017 1 commit
  4. 23 Nov, 2016 1 commit
  5. 22 Nov, 2016 1 commit
  6. 15 Jun, 2015 1 commit
  7. 02 Apr, 2015 1 commit
  8. 28 Nov, 2014 1 commit
  9. 22 Jul, 2014 1 commit
  10. 07 Apr, 2014 1 commit
    • Andrew Wedgbury's avatar
      Make sure config.h is included before any system headers · 9cd661e7
      Andrew Wedgbury authored
      
      
      There was an issue recently in screen-share.c where config.h was not
      being included, resulting in the wrong definition for off_t being used on
      32 bit systems. I checked and I don't think this problem is happening
      elsewhere, but to help avoid this sort of problem in the future, I went
      through and made sure that config.h is included first whenever system
      headers are included.
      
      The config.h header should be included before any system headers, failing
      to do this can result in the wrong type sizes being defined on certain
      systems, e.g. off_t from sys/types.h
      Signed-off-by: default avatarAndrew Wedgbury <andrew.wedgbury@realvnc.com>
      9cd661e7
  11. 16 Nov, 2013 1 commit
    • Pekka Paalanen's avatar
      protocol: move sub-surfaces to Wayland · a662206e
      Pekka Paalanen authored
      This reverts commit 2396aec6
      
      .
      
      This exact version of the sub-surface protocol has been copied into
      Wayland core. Therefore it must be removed from here to avoid build
      conflicts and useless duplication.
      
      No other changes to sub-surface protocol consumers are needed, the
      identical API is now offered by libwayland-client and libwayland-server.
      
      The commit adding sub-surfaces to Wayland is:
      Author: Pekka Paalanen <pekka.paalanen@collabora.co.uk>
      
          protocol: add sub-surfaces to the core
      Signed-off-by: Pekka Paalanen's avatarPekka Paalanen <pekka.paalanen@collabora.co.uk>
      a662206e
  12. 17 May, 2013 2 commits
  13. 10 May, 2013 1 commit
    • Pekka Paalanen's avatar
      tests: add sub-surface protocol tests · e844bf2a
      Pekka Paalanen authored
      
      
      For testing the protocol behaviour only:
      - linking a surface to a parent does not fail
      - position and placement requests do not fail
      - bad linking and arguments do fail
      - passing a surface as a sibling from a different set fails
      - different destruction sequences do not crash
      - setting a surface as its own parent fails
      - nesting succeeds
      Signed-off-by: Pekka Paalanen's avatarPekka Paalanen <ppaalanen@gmail.com>
      e844bf2a